China poised for manned space docking mission

THREE astronauts, including one female, have arrived at the Jiuquan Satellite Launch Center in northwestern Gansu Province as China is poised to launch the Shenzhou-9 manned spacecraft in mid-June.

The three astronauts arrived on Saturday and have gone through required tests. It's the first time that a female Chinese astronaut will join a space mission, the Lanzhou Morning Post reported today.

Shenzhou-9 will perform China's first manned space docking mission with the orbiting Tiangong-1 space lab module, it said.

Live butterflies will also be taken into the space for scientific experiments, the report said.
